About TikToks and Tubers: Gen Z's YouTube Habits
Gen Z is known for its creative approach to consuming media, sometimes finding different ways to engage with content. This pattern is evident in their YouTube habits, which are deeply influenced by the rise of platforms like TikTok. While traditional YouTubers remain popular, Gen Z has a increasing appetite for bite-sized videos that are fast-paced. This preference is driving the YouTube landscape, with creators adapting their format to cater to Gen Z's viewing patterns.
- Furthermore, Gen Z isn't just watching YouTube passively. They are actively engaging with the platform through comments, and many even wish for becoming YouTubers themselves.

Trending Topics on YouTube: The Power of Niche Content
YouTube has always been a platform for diverse content, but in recent years there's been an undeniable trend toward niche content. Viewers are increasingly seeking out videos that cater to their particular hobbies, leading to the growth of channels dedicated to everything from unusual skills to highly specific topics. This trend is driven by several factors, including the desire for authenticity among viewers, as well as the effectiveness of targeted videos to build loyal followings.
- As a result, YouTube has become a more dynamic and immersive environment.
- Specialized YouTubers are finding greater success in these focused spaces.

Unlocking Insights for Success on YouTube
YouTube Analytics is a powerful tool that Youtube provides valuable insights into your channel's performance. By analyzing data such as watch time, you can identify what content resonates with your audience and improve your strategy for success.
Regularly reviewing your analytics can help you in making informed decisions about the type of content you generate, when to post it, and how to advertise your channel.
Whether you're a beginner or an established influencer, YouTube Analytics is an essential resource for attaining your channel goals.
